Why is it that some companies scale faster and more efficiently than others, when they have access to the same resources as everyone else?  Funding, head count, resources––these things don’t guarantee success in any business.  So, what is it that separates the companies that scale efficiently from the ones that struggle to get off the ground? On RevOps Champions, we talk with some of the brightest minds in B2B leadership to answer this very question. RevOps is a B2B function that uses automation to help teams make decisions that grow the business. It represents the convergence of marketing, sales, and customer service and has four components: people, process, data, and technology.
